*r. and Mr. S**th.avi *r. and Mr. S*th.avi I downloaded this movie last night. It wouldn't run in my Windows Media Player, saying it didn't recognize the codec. Now, when I try to delete the file, it says it can't because it is being used by another program. I think this might be a malicious file. Any suggestions how I can delete this file, and find out what the other program is that prevents me from deleting this file. Thanks |
Hi Larry, First your not supposed to name the files. Thats piracy talk and is against the Forum Rules. You may have d/led a virus. One way to avoid this is to look-up the file with "bitzi" first. How to use Bitzi Web Lookup Try deleting it from your shared folder with LW shut down. The default location is C:\Documents and Settings\"your account name"\Shared. If that doesn't work try deleting it in safe mode, and run your anti-virus. Also check out this thread: WARNING: Viruses on network you should be aware of! |
Bad File Pac, Thanks for the tips. I was somehow able to delete the file. First I deleted its listing in the LW library. Then it was gone from the Share folder. I'll check out the threads you mentioned. Larry |
